fix: Fix undefined function _t on WebSub (#2743)

I published an article via WebSub, but I never received it. So I checked
my logs to find why and I found the following stacktrace:

```
29/Dec/2019:15:58:32 +0000 "POST /api/pshb.php" 500
NOTICE: PHP message: PHP Fatal error:  Uncaught Error: Call to undefined function _t() in /path/app/Models/Category.php:83
Stack trace:
/path/app/Models/CategoryDAO.php(417): FreshRSS_Category->_id(1)
/path/app/Models/CategoryDAO.php(192): FreshRSS_CategoryDAO::daoToCategory(Array)
/path/app/Models/Feed.php(466): FreshRSS_CategoryDAO->searchById('1')
/path/app/Controllers/feedController.php(416): FreshRSS_Feed->cleanOldEntries()
/path/p/api/pshb.php(141): FreshRSS_feed_Controller::actualizeFeed(0, 'https://flus.io...', false, Object(SimplePie))
{main}
  thrown in /path/app/Models/Category.php on line 83
```

The `_t` function should be loaded with the Minz_Translate class, but
the latter isn't initialized on WebSub endpoint.

In my opinion, we should not have to care about this kind of detail of
implementation and it reveals a deeper architectural misconception, but
for now the fix should be enough. It’s quite difficult to reproduce
locally though.
